DUNBAR, W.Va. (WSAZ) -- Keeping people safer on the roads and paying jail fees efficiently were among issues addressed Monday night by Dunbar City Council.
Council members say after receiving numerous complaints about not being able to see disabled folks on motorized wheel chairs, they're going to be handing out reflective flags. They say it's all in an effort to prevent accidents.
Meanwhile, the jail fee is going up in Dunbar, but the money will not be coming out of residents’ pockets or the city's budget.
Council members approved an ordinance to put more unpaid inmate fees back on the inmate instead of the city.
Until now, Council says the Regional Jail Authority billed the city after inmates failed to pay up.
